Inquiries about Goods from Russia

Are you interested in purchasing goods from Russia? Whether you’re a business owner looking for new suppliers or an individual interested in unique Russian products, this blog post will provide you with valuable information on how to make inquiries about goods from Russia.

1. Research Potential Suppliers

Before making any inquiries, it’s important to research potential suppliers in Russia. Look for companies that specialize in the type of goods you’re interested in. Check their reputation, read reviews, and ensure they have the necessary certifications and licenses.

2. Determine Your Requirements

Prior to reaching out to suppliers, determine your specific requirements. Consider factors such as quantity, quality standards, packaging, delivery timelines, and any other specifications that are important to you. This will help you communicate your needs effectively when making inquiries.

3. Contact Suppliers

Once you have a shortlist of potential suppliers, it’s time to make inquiries. Most suppliers in Russia can be contacted via email or through their websites. Introduce yourself, briefly explain your interest in their products, and clearly state your requirements. Be polite, professional, and concise in your communication.

4. Ask for Product Information

When making inquiries, it’s essential to ask for detailed product information. Request product catalogs, brochures, or any other relevant documentation that provides a comprehensive overview of the goods you’re interested in. This will help you assess the suitability of the products for your needs.

5. Inquire about Pricing and Payment Terms

Price is a crucial factor when considering goods from Russia. Inquire about pricing, including any discounts for bulk orders or long-term partnerships. Additionally, discuss payment terms, such as whether they accept international payments and the preferred method of payment.

6. Seek Clarification on Shipping and Customs

Shipping and customs processes can be complex when importing goods from Russia. Seek clarification from the supplier regarding shipping options, estimated delivery times, and any customs requirements or restrictions. It’s important to be aware of any additional costs or documentation needed.

7. Request Samples

If you’re unsure about the quality or suitability of the goods, it’s advisable to request samples before making a larger order. Most suppliers are willing to provide samples for a nominal fee or sometimes even for free. This will give you a firsthand experience of the product’s quality.

8. Evaluate Supplier Responsiveness

During the inquiry process, pay attention to the supplier’s responsiveness and willingness to address your questions and concerns. A reliable supplier should be prompt in their communication and provide clear and satisfactory answers. This will give you an indication of their professionalism and commitment to customer service.

9. Consider Cultural Differences

When making inquiries with suppliers from Russia, it’s important to be aware of cultural differences. Russians may have different communication styles and business practices compared to your own. Be respectful, patient, and open-minded to ensure effective communication and a smooth business relationship.

10. Follow Up and Make a Decision

After receiving responses from suppliers, take the time to review and compare the information provided. Follow up with any additional questions or clarifications you may have. Once you have gathered all the necessary information, make an informed decision based on the supplier’s suitability for your requirements.

By following these steps, you can make effective inquiries about goods from Russia and find reliable suppliers for your business or personal needs. Remember to do thorough research, clearly communicate your requirements, and evaluate suppliers based on their responsiveness and professionalism. Good luck with your inquiries!
